Daughtry is an American rock band formed in North Carolina in 2006 by singer Chris Daughtry after his appearance on American Idol. The band’s self-titled debut established its post-grunge and hard-rock sound through songs including “It’s Not Over,” “Home” and “Over You,” while later albums include Leave This Town and Break the Spell. Daughtry opened arena dates for Bon Jovi on the Lost Highway Tour in 2008. The band later mounted the Break the Spell Tour and followed it with a co-headlining tour alongside 3 Doors Down.
